Sonepur: Amidst several reports of irregularities in mandis, more lapses have surfaced after some farmers in Odisha reportedly received payments twice in their bank accounts after paddy procurement.

According to reports, over 800 farmers in Sonepur district received such double transfers against their sale of paddy in the current season.

Sources said funds to the tune of nearly Rs 80 lakh has been credited from State Cooperative Bank’s Bhubaneswar branch as payments in the accounts of several farmers in the district.

“Due to some server error, double payments were made to the bank accounts of farmers,” said Sonepur district civil supplies officer, Bibekanand Korkara.
